13. Troubleshooting

This model was built using the latest technology. However, faults and malfunction may still occur. The following section
shows you how to troubleshoot potential problems. Ensure that you also read the remote control operating instructions
included with the product.
The model does not respond or responds incorrectly
• In the case of 2.4 GHz remote controls, the receiver must be connected to the transmitter. This process is known
as "binding" or "pairing". Please also note the operating instructions for the remote control.
• Is the vehicle drive battery or the transmitter batteries/rechargeable batteries empty? Replace the drive battery or
batteries/rechargeable batteries in the transmitter with new ones.
• Did you switch on the transmitter before switching on the speed controller?
• Is the drive battery connected to the speed controller correctly? Check the connection to see if it is dirty or oxidised.
• Is the vehicle too far away? With a fully charged drive battery and batteries/rechargeable batteries in the transmitter,
a minimum range of 50 m should be possible. However, it can be reduced by outside influences, such as interfer-
ence on the radio frequency or the proximity of other transmitters (not only remote control transmitters, but also
Wi-Fi/Bluetooth
devices that also use a transmission frequency of 2.4 GHz), metal parts, buildings, etc.
®
The position of the transmitter and receiver antennas relative to each other also has a significant impact on the
range. For best results, the transmitter and receiver antennas should be vertical (i.e. parallel to each other). Pointing
the transmitter antenna at the vehicle significantly reduces the range.
• Check the correct position of the speed controller plug and steering servo on the receiver. If the plugs have been
rotated 180°, the speed controller and steering servo will not work.
If the connectors for the speed controller and steering servo are swapped, the throttle/brake lever will control the
steering servo and the rotary control will control the drive function!
The vehicle doesn't stop when the throttle/brake lever is released
• Correct the throttle trim on the transmitter (set the neutral position).
• Reprogramme the neutral position on the speed controller (and the full throttle position for forward and reverse
drive) if your speed controller has this function.
The vehicle travels slowly or the steering servo does not respond properly to remote control commands; the
range between the transmitter and the vehicle is very short
• The drive battery is nearly empty.
Modern electronic speed controllers have a built-in BEC that ensures power supply of the receiver and steering
servo. As a result, the receiver will not function properly when the drive battery is nearly empty. Replace the drive
battery with a fully charged drive battery (before changing the battery, wait for at least 5–10 minutes for the motor
and speed controller to cool down).
• Check the batteries/rechargeable batteries in the transmitter.
